Abstract
The composite system Mg-ZrFe1.4Cr0.6 was synthesized by mechanical grinding of Mg mixed with various amounts of ZrFe1.4Cr0.6. The hydrogenation perfor mance of Mg in the composite system was markedly enhanced, especially for M g-40 wt.% ZrFe1.4Cr0.6. SEM, TEM, EDS and X-ray diffraction were used to ch aracterize the composite. The full exploitation of the catalytic function o f ZrFe1.4Cr0.6 and the nanostructure of Mg were found to be the main reason s for the markedly improved hydriding kinetics of the composite.
